在医药行业的广阔天地中,创新药研发如同一位勇敢的探险家,在未知的领域里探寻着生命的奥秘。今天,我们就通过一幅漫画,来揭开创新药研发的神秘面纱,了解其中的奥秘与挑战。
创新药研发的起点:灵感与发现
漫画中的主角是一位年轻的科学家,他坐在实验室里,眼前是一堆复杂的化学分子模型。他的脑海中闪过一个个想法,这些想法就像一颗颗种子,孕育着未来的创新药物。
灵感的来源
创新药的灵感往往来源于对现有药物不足的发现,或是从自然界中提取的活性成分。科学家们通过研究疾病的发生机制,寻找能够干预这些机制的分子靶点。
发现新靶点
漫画中的科学家通过显微镜观察细胞,发现了一种新的蛋白质,这个蛋白质与某种疾病密切相关。这就是新靶点的发现,它是创新药研发的基石。
创新药研发的旅程:从实验室到市场
药物设计
在确定了新靶点后,科学家们开始设计药物分子,这些分子需要能够特异性地结合到靶点上,并抑制其活性。
代码示例:药物分子设计
# 假设我们设计一个能够结合到新靶点的药物分子
class DrugMolecule:
def __init__(self, name, target):
self.name = name
self.target = target
def bind_to_target(self):
# 模拟药物分子与靶点结合的过程
print(f"{self.name} has bound to {self.target}")
# 创建一个药物分子实例
drug = DrugMolecule("MoleculeX", "TargetProtein")
drug.bind_to_target()
药物合成
设计出药物分子后,科学家们需要将其合成出来。这一过程涉及复杂的化学反应,需要精确控制条件。
代码示例:药物合成模拟
# 模拟药物合成过程
def synthesize_drug(molecule):
# 模拟合成过程
print(f"Synthesizing {molecule.name}...")
# 假设合成成功
return molecule
# 合成药物分子
drug = synthesize_drug(drug)
print(f"{drug.name} has been synthesized.")
临床试验
药物分子合成出来后,需要进行临床试验,以验证其安全性和有效性。
代码示例:临床试验模拟
# 模拟临床试验过程
def clinical_trial(drug):
# 模拟临床试验
print(f"Conducting clinical trial for {drug.name}...")
# 假设临床试验成功
return True
# 进行临床试验
clinical_trial_success = clinical_trial(drug)
print(f"Clinical trial for {drug.name} was {'successful' if clinical_trial_success else 'unsuccessful'}.")
创新药研发的挑战
资金投入
创新药研发需要巨额的资金投入,从实验室研究到临床试验,每一步都需要大量的资金支持。
研发周期长
从发现新靶点到药物上市,整个过程可能需要十年甚至更长时间。
竞争激烈
医药行业竞争激烈,新药研发的成功率很低,只有少数药物能够最终上市。
总结
创新药研发是一条充满挑战的道路,但也是一条充满希望的道路。正如漫画中的科学家一样,只要我们坚持不懈,就一定能够找到生命的奥秘,为人类健康事业做出贡献。
